Saudi Arabia plans to move forward with earlier store closure hours this year, to shut by 9:00 pm

Saudi Arabia is planning to enforce earlier retail store closure hours during 2016, according to sources quoted by Okaz newspaper. The decision, which has been discussed since early 2014, will include some exceptions and is awaiting approval by the cabinet. The article added that there will be advance warning before the new hours are implemented. The decision also includes reducing working hours to 40 per week in an effort to bolster Saudisation. As with the shift in the kingdom’s weekend days, consumers will likely adjust shopping habits to accommodate for the reduced shopping hours over time, in our view. (Argaam, Hatem Alaa, Nada Amin)
